Metro’s Super Erecta shelf ledge delivers organized containment and safer storage for busy kitchens, service lines, and storage rooms. Designed for 24" widths, the stainless finish provides corrosion resistance and a clean appearance while the 4" height keeps items secured on side or back edges whether shelving sits stationary or moves on carts.

#@@# Stainless Finish#@#
The stainless-steel construction resists corrosion in humid dishroom and kitchen environments and simplifies sanitation workflows. Facility staff maintain hygiene routines with fewer specialized cleaners because stainless surfaces wipe clean and withstand frequent use.
#@@# Twenty-Four Inch Width#@#
Sized for standard shelving bays and utility carts, the 24" width integrates with common Super Erecta racks and streamlines retrofits. Maintenance teams reduce downtime during reconfiguration because the ledge aligns with existing modular components.
#@@# Four Inch Height#@#
The 4" rise contains small items and prevents spillover on shelf edges without obstructing visibility or access. Line cooks and stock clerks retrieve ingredients faster since the ledge secures loose packages without creating a high barrier.
#@@# Side Or Back Use#@#
Engineers designed the ledge for installation along side or back edges to adapt to product flow and shelving layouts. Operations managers optimize throughput by placing ledges where containment matters most, such as near prep stations or along transport routes.
#@@# Stationary Or Mobile#@#
Compatibility with both stationary racks and mobile installations enables consistent containment across the facility. Transport teams reduce loss and improve safety when moving stocked shelves between prep, serving, and storage areas.
#@@# Stackable Design#@#
Stackable construction supports efficient storage when ledges are not in use and allows modular layering during peak demand. Procurement staff conserve storage space and simplify inventory management because unneeded ledges nest cleanly.
